In the dynamic world of startups, innovation and entrepreneurship know no bounds. From the bustling tech meccas of Silicon Valley to the emerging Startup scenes in Frankfurt, Germany, and Karachi, Pakistan, each location offers its own unique opportunities and challenges for aspiring entrepreneurs. 1. **US Startup Ecosystem:** The United States, especially Silicon Valley, is synonymous with startup success stories. With a vibrant ecosystem that includes top-tier universities, access to venture capital, and a culture that celebrates risk-taking and innovation, the US remains a magnet for entrepreneurs from around the world. Companies like Google, Facebook, and Amazon trace their roots back to the US startup scene, inspiring countless others to follow suit. 2. **Frankfurt, Germany:** Located at the heart of Europe, Frankfurt has emerged as a key player in the continent's startup landscape. With a strong financial sector, a skilled workforce, and a supportive government, Frankfurt offers a promising environment for startups looking to tap into the European market. The city's proximity to other major European cities and its excellent infrastructure further enhance its appeal as a startup hub. 3. **Karachi, Pakistan:** In recent years, Karachi has been making waves in the global startup community. With a large young population, a growing middle class, and a thriving tech scene, Pakistan's largest city is attracting attention as a potential hub for tech startups. Initiatives like incubators, accelerators, and startup competitions are helping to nurture a new generation of entrepreneurs in Karachi, paving the way for future success stories. 4. **Challenges and Opportunities:** While each location offers distinct advantages for startups, they also present their own set of challenges. In the US, competition is fierce, and the high cost of living and doing business can be a deterrent for some entrepreneurs. In Frankfurt, navigating the complex regulatory environment and building connections in the local business community can pose challenges for newcomers. Karachi, on the other hand, grapples with issues like infrastructure limitations and political instability, which can hinder the growth of startups in the city. In conclusion, the startup ecosystems in the US, Frankfurt, and Karachi all have something unique to offer to entrepreneurs seeking to turn their innovative ideas into successful businesses. Whether it's access to capital, a supportive network of mentors, or a burgeoning market ripe for disruption, each location provides its own set of opportunities for startups to thrive and make a mark on the global stage. As the world of entrepreneurship continues to evolve, these diverse startup hubs will undoubtedly play a crucial role in shaping the future of innovation and technology.
